Description

The Toscana Rosso I Sodi di San Niccolò di Castellare di Castellina comes from vineyards located in the municipality of Castellina in Chianti.

It is mainly produced from Sangiovese and Malvasia Nera grapes, harvested after the middle of October. Fermentation takes place in stainless steel tanks at a controlled temperature of 28 ° C for 15-18 days. Subsequently the wine ages in barriques for up to 30 months, depending on the vintage, and for a further 12 months in bottle.

Characterized by an intense red color, with garnet reflections, it opens to the nose with an intense bouquet of hints of cherries, enriched with pleasant spicy notes. On the palate it is soft and full, with velvety tannins and a pleasantly fruity finish.

Perfect to accompany cold cuts and red meats, it is ideal in combination with aged cheeses.
